The PIP 22-600M is a cut-resistant work glove from the Kutgard line, designed for trades and industrial applications where hand protection against sharp edges and cut hazards is required. The glove is constructed from a combination of Kevlar fiber and three strands of stainless steel wire core interwoven with polyester, delivering substantial cut resistance without sacrificing dexterity. A sand grip finish on the palm and fingers improves control when handling sheet metal, glass, or other sharp materials. This glove is sold individually (each) and is sized at a size 7 in white.
The 22-600M is suited for light to medium-duty cut hazard environments including sheet metal handling, HVAC duct fabrication, electrical conduit work, plumbing rough-in, and general mechanical assembly. It is appropriate for trade professionals who require reliable cut protection during repetitive handling tasks. The sand grip finish makes it functional in dry conditions where grip and tactile feedback matter.

Inspect gloves for wire core integrity before each use, as broken steel strands can create internal puncture risks. Replace immediately if the outer shell shows fraying or wire protrusion. Always match glove size to hand measurements to ensure proper fit and cut protection performance. Follow applicable ANSI cut-level standards and site safety requirements when selecting hand protection for a specific task.
